Our approach to septic system service emphasizes thoroughness and adherence to established engineering principles. When we perform a pump-out, for example, we don't just remove the liquid; we ensure the tank is properly agitated to break up the scum layer and sludge, allowing for a more complete removal of solids. This prevents premature buildup and extends the time between necessary services. For repairs, we use schedule 40 PVC for all buried lines and fittings, which provides superior durability against root intrusion and ground movement compared to thinner-walled alternatives.

Richmond homeowners should typically have their septic tank pumped every 3 to 5 years, depending on household size and tank capacity. A smaller tank serving a larger family will require more frequent pumping, often closer to the 3-year mark, because increased wastewater volume accelerates sludge and scum accumulation. Regular inspections can help determine the exact rate of accumulation, allowing us to recommend a precise schedule tailored to your system's specific usage patterns and the type of septic system you have installed, whether it's a conventional gravity system or an aerobic treatment unit.
Common signs of a failing septic system in Richmond include slow drains or backups in your home, which indicate a blockage or hydraulic overload within the system. You might also notice standing water or unusually lush, green grass over your drain field, suggesting that effluent is surfacing prematurely. A persistent foul odor around your septic tank or drain field is another strong indicator of a problem, often caused by untreated wastewater escaping or an issue with the tank's ventilation. Addressing these signs promptly can prevent more extensive and costly repairs.
Aerobic septic systems in Richmond require more frequent and specific maintenance than conventional systems, typically involving quarterly or semi-annual inspections by a licensed professional. These inspections focus on ensuring the aerator pump is functioning correctly to introduce oxygen into the treatment tank, which is crucial for the breakdown of waste by beneficial bacteria. We also check the chlorine contact chamber for proper disinfection, inspect the spray heads for even distribution, and verify that the control panel and alarms are operating as intended. This proactive maintenance schedule is essential for compliance with Fort Bend County regulations and for the system's long-term effectiveness.
